Output 63f258a878e8738211880ac5efb7cd2e29aa8b6ceb14441c02a7c66da8794435:6

value
5140077498032
script pubkey
OP_0 OP_PUSHBYTES_20 744a1a88570381f91a7d2fc2cf16988b2d62dbd8
address
tb1qw39p4zzhqwqljxna9lpv795c3vkk9k7c96z0v0
transaction
63f258a878e8738211880ac5efb7cd2e29aa8b6ceb14441c02a7c66da8794435
confirmations
61721
spent
true